At the Time of the Closure of Lists, They Again Denounce in Lla an Alleged "Sale of Candidacies"

Summary by Perfil
Two leaders of the ruling party in Mar Chiquita brought the issue to justice, with documents and audios. They assure that some of the owners of the lists "seek to remove liberals from the province of Buenos Aires to put other people", and favor that "kirchnerism retains power within the deliberative councils." A few hours after the closure of lists for the legislative elections, a serious scandal broke out in La Libertad Avanza (LLA) of the province of Buenos Aires. It all began when two leaders of the space filed a judicial complaint against the provincial party leadership, led by Sebastián Pareja and his second, Alejandro Carrancio, accusing them of selling candidatures to leaders linked to Kirchnerism, which generated a strong shock within the ruli…
